TouchStone Software

TouchStone Software Corporation, Inc., founded in 1982, is an American software developer for the personal computer (PC) industry, specializing in system update technology.[1][2] It also owns and operates a network of Internet Web properties. Based in Marco Island, Florida, the company was a subsidiary of Phoenix Technologies until 2010 [3][4] when it was acquired by the former management team who sold the company to Phoenix Technology in 2008.

The company's portfolio of Internet properties serve as the main outlet to deliver its software products, such as RegistryWizard, DriverAgent and BIOS Agent.

Products

  • PC Works / Unihost / Macline - communications programs that allow computers to link with IBM PC's using modems[2]
  • Checklt & WinChecklt - Diagnostic Kit[5]
  • PC-cillin - Antivirus[6][7]
  • e.support[8]
  • e.checkit[8]
  • UndeletePlus
  • Registry Wizard
  • Software Updater
  • NTFS Undelete
